This workshop is intended for those with some prior clay experience. Participants are welcome to create their raku pieces using either wheel throwing or handbuilding techniques in advance of the workshop. Please reach out to organize picking up your included clay. The experience will take place over two sessions at the ClayWorks Studio: Session 1 - Instruction & Glazing - August 31st from 6:00 - 9:00 pm We will cover the basics of raku firing, including safety, techniques, and materials. Participants will glaze their previously bisque-fired pieces in preparation for firing. Session 2 – Outdoor Raku Firing - September 2nd from either 1:00 - 4:00 pm or 6:00 - 9:00 pm Participants will return for the firing session, held outdoors in the studio parking lot. You may choose either the afternoon or evening timeslot. This is where the magic happens, as we fire and reduce your glazed pieces. The Guild will provide some shared bins, combustibles, and a limited number of extra gloves for use during the firing. What to bring Session 1 Up to 6 bisque-fired pots (Please note: we cannot guarantee all pieces will be fired, depending on size and total volume. We will do our best to accommodate as many as possible.) Brushes for applying glaze Session 2 Your glazed pots Natural fibre clothing (long-sleeved cotton shirt, long pants, closed-toe shoes or boots) Hat or scarf, and long hair tied back Metal reduction containers/bins with tight-fitting lids (for your pots) Combustibles (shredded paper, newspaper, wood shavings) Leather gloves What’s included All raku glazes, firing, and a half bag of raku clay are included in the class fee. Additional raku clay will be available for purchase at the studio (price TBD). If you anticipate needing extra clay, please let us know in advance so we can ensure adequate supply.
